Amselfall

The Amselfall is a 10 meter high waterfall near Rathewalde-Hohnstein in the region Sachsen, Germany. The Amselfall is near the Amselsee, a lake being fed by the river Amselgrundbach that ends in one of the larger rivers in Germany, the Elbe.

The Amselfall is a little bit a peculiar waterfall that only flows if you pay a small fee. It is only possible to visit the Amselfall from april until october.

From Dresden drive southeast to Heidenau where you have to cross the river Elbe (S177) and the drive on to Lohmen and Rathewalde. In Rathewalde there is a parking behind the church from where the trail starts to the Amselfall. It will take appr 10 minutes (1 kilometer) before you reach the Amselfall.
